
Why subway tile is backsplash all-time favorite? Ceramic subway tile is still one of the most famous kitchen and bathroom styles over a century later. Tiles are now available in an unlimited variety of colors and finishes to match any décor. They've even transitioned from kitchens and bathrooms to other high-traffic areas that require long-lasting, easy-to-clean surfaces, such as laundry rooms, mudrooms, and fireplace surrounds. So, what's the big deal with subway tiles? They're durable enough to last for decades—the glue, grout, and caulk used to install them will almost certainly need to be replaced far before the tiles themselves.
